Recreational Vehicle Park, Recreation Camps,
Combined & Temporary
Park- Camps
Regulations: Ohio Revised Code, Chapter 3733, Ohio
Administrative Code, Chapter 3701-25
 | Recreational Vehicle Park is any tract of land
used for parking five or more self-contained recreational vehicles and
includes any roadway, building, structure, vehicle, or enclosure used or
intended for use as part of the park facilities and any tract of land
that is subdivided for lease or other contract of the individual sites
for the express or implied purpose of placing self-contained
recreational vehicles for recreation, vacation, or business.
|
 | Recreation Camp is any tract of land upon which
five or more portable camping units are placed, and includes any
roadway, building, structure, vehicle, or enclose used or intended for
use as part of the facilities of such camp.
|
 | Combined Park Camp means any tract of land upon
which a combination of five or more self-contained recreational vehicles
or portable camping units are placed and includes any roadway, building,
structure, vehicle, or enclosure used or intended for use as part of the
park facilities.
|
 | Temporary Park-Camp is any tract of land used
for a period not to exceed a total of twenty-one days per calendar year
for the purpose of parking five or more recreational vehicles, dependent
recreational vehicles, or portable camping units, or any combination
thereof, for one or more periods of time that do not exceed seven
consecutive days or parts thereof.
